The Role of Maize Reaper Machines
Maize reaper machines are specialized agricultural implements designed to harvest maize crops efficiently. They come in various forms, including self-propelled combines, tractor-drawn reapers, and smaller handheld options for small-scale farmers. The primary purpose of these machines is to automate the harvesting process, enabling farmers to collect maize quickly and efficiently, minimizing losses that might occur if harvested manually.
The traditional manual harvesting method is not only labor-intensive but also time-consuming. Farmers often face challenges such as adverse weather conditions and labor shortages during peak harvesting times. The introduction of maize reaper machines alleviates these pressures by allowing harvesting to occur in a timely manner, ensuring that crops are collected when they are at their optimum maturity. This timely harvesting is crucial in preventing maize from being damaged or spoiled by pests or adverse weather conditions.
Advantages of Using Maize Reaper Machines
The advantages of maize reaper machines are multifaceted, enhancing productivity, efficiency, and economic viability for farmers. Here are some of the primary benefits
1. Increased Efficiency Maize reaper machines can significantly speed up the harvesting process. Where a team of workers may take days to harvest a field manually, a reaper can accomplish the same task in a matter of hours. This efficiency allows farmers to reallocate labor resources to other critical farming tasks.
2. Improved Crop Quality Harvesting maize at the right time is vital for retaining the quality of the crop. Maize reaper machines can precisely cut the stalks without damaging the ears of corn, leading to higher quality yield. This is essential, particularly in markets where crop quality directly affects prices.
3. Reduced Labor Costs Labor costs in agriculture can be substantial, especially in regions where the labor force is shrinking. By utilizing a maize reaper machine, farmers can reduce the number of laborers needed during the harvest season. This not only cuts labor costs but also mitigates the challenges associated with hiring seasonal workers.
4. Enhanced Safety Harvesting with handheld tools can pose safety risks, including cuts, falls, and exposure to harsh weather. Maize reaper machines provide a safer alternative, as operators are seated and protected from elements while using these machines.
5. Scalability For farmers looking to expand their operations, maize reaper machines allow for scalability. As crop yields increase, the capability to harvest larger areas with the same workforce becomes feasible. This scalability is essential for farmers aiming to increase their market presence and profitability.
